Raman Spectroscopy for Advanced Polymeric Biomaterials.

Garima Agrawal1, Sangram K Samal2.   

Abstract

In recent years, polymeric biomaterials have emerged as a potential candidate for therapeutic applications owing to their salient features. The characterization of these drugs and bioactive molecules loaded polymer based biomaterials is an important prerequisite for obtaining a deep understanding of their physicochemical behavior in order to ensure their successful clinical use. There are a variety of complementary characterization techniques available for the characterization of the biomaterials. This review highlights the potential of Raman spectroscopy including its importance for investigating the molecular structure of polymeric materials along with a brief description of its principles, instrumentation, and recent advances.
